Classroom Readiness Skills

Each week, teachers track your child’s skills to celebrate progress and set new goals. At Robin’s Nest, advancement is based on skills and readiness—not just age—so every milestone paves the way for a confident step into the next classroom.

Trust & Social-Emotional Development

Building one-on-one bonds, establishing a sense of security, and developing trust through love and consistent interactions.

Physical & Motor Development

Strengthening muscles and coordination through tummy time, handling sippy cups, utensils, and early fine motor activities like painting or coloring.

Communication & Social Interaction

Using simple words, gestures, or signs to express needs; showing awareness of teachers and peers.

Cognitive & Problem-Solving Skills

Exploring cause-and-effect with toys, learning to fit objects into puzzle boxes, and engaging curiosity through hands-on play.
